Application Support Specialist Jobs in New Jersey
Application Support Specialist jobs in New Jersey are concentrated in Newark, Trenton, and the Jersey City financial corridor, where demand for enterprise application support runs deep across healthcare IT, financial services, and state government systems. Major employers with established New Jersey operations including Johnson & Johnson, Cognizant, and Conduent regularly hire at both entry and senior levels. The most in-demand specialties are ERP support, Salesforce administration, and ticketing-system management for large institutional environments. Position Summary
The Application Support Manager leads a team responsible for the production support, stability, availability, and operational readiness of business-critical banking applications. This role oversees Incident, Problem, Change, Release, and Disaster Recovery processes while partnering with Business, Application Development, Infrastructure, Middleware, Cloud, Security, and Vendor teams to deliver reliable and compliant technology services. The manager is accountable for service availability, operational excellence, team leadership, and continuous improvement.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ead and manage Application Support teams providing L1, L2, and L3 production support.
- Ensure 24x7 support coverage and operational support for business-critical applications.
- Manage Major Incidents, production outages, escalations, root cause analysis, and corrective action plans.
- Oversee application onboarding, Operational Readiness Reviews (ORR), production acceptance, and support transitions
- Lead Disaster Recovery planning, testing, and recovery validation activities
- Drive SLA attainment, operational metrics, reporting, automation, and continuous service improvement initiatives.
- Develop and maintain SOPs, runbooks, operational documentation, and audit-ready support processes
- Manage relationships with business stakeholders, application owners, vendors, and technology teams

Application Support Specialist Jobs in New Jersey: Frequently Asked Questions
How do you become an application support specialist in New Jersey?
Most employers in New Jersey require a bachelor's degree in information technology, computer science, or a related discipline, though some accept an associate degree combined with substantial hands-on experience. There is no state-issued license for this role in New Jersey. Earning vendor certifications such as Salesforce Administrator, Microsoft Azure Fundamentals, or ITIL Foundation strengthens your profile significantly with New Jersey employers in financial services, healthcare IT, and state government contracting.

How can I get hired as an application support specialist in New Jersey with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path is moving from a help-desk analyst or IT support technician role into application support, since New Jersey employers routinely promote internally from those adjacent positions. Large New Jersey healthcare networks like RWJBarnabas Health and Hackensack Meridian Health run IT associate programs that accept candidates without deep application-specific backgrounds. Earning an ITIL Foundation certification or a Salesforce Administrator credential before applying gives candidates a concrete edge when competing for junior openings at New Jersey state agency contractors.
